DOES IT WORK?
It's just a filler. Plant-based maltodextrin is a rapidly digested carbohydrate used as a carrier or bulking agent. No therapeutic value on its own.

Rapidly broken down into glucose. Serves as a carrier and bulking agent in supplement formulations.
